Are smell receptors slow adapting or rapidly adapting receptors?

are smell receptors slow adapting or rapidly adapting receptors? Olfactory sensory neurons have been shown to rapidly adapt to repetitive odorant stimuli (Kurahashi and Shibuya, 1990; Kurahashi and Menini, 1997; Leinders-Zufall et al., 1998; Ma et al., 1999; Reisert and Matthews, 1999; Reisert and Matthews, 2001; Ma et al., 2003).

Are olfactory receptors slow adapting? It is of interest to note in this context that both multiunit (Ottoson, 1956) and single-unit (Getchell and Shepherd, 1978) electrophysiological recordings in animals suggest that olfactory receptors adapt relatively slowly.

Do smell receptors adapt? This process is known as adaptation, and is a common feature in all sensory modalities. Adaptation in olfaction allows the olfactory system to maintain equilibrium with the odorant concentrations in the ambient environment, yet respond appropriately to the appearance of novel odors or changes in odorant concentration.

How long does olfactory adaptation take? Half-maximal adaptation occurred after 15 sec of exposure to an odor, and recovery occurred with a half-time of 1.5 min, under a set of test conditions.

what are g protein modulated receptors?

G-protein-coupled receptors (GPCRs) are the largest family of cell-surface receptors, accounting for >1% of the human genome. GPCRs respond to a wide variety of extracellular signals, including peptides, ions, amino acids, hormones, growth factors, light and odorant molecules.

where are death receptors located?

Death receptors are expressed on many cell types, especially in the immune system, where they have apoptotic and nonapoptotic functions, dependent on cell context. The cytoplasmic sequences of members of the death receptor superfamily all contain the death domain (DD 80 aa) protein-interaction motif.

What does anti-NMDA receptor encephalitis feel like?

Anti-NMDA receptor encephalitis is a type of brain inflammation caused by antibodies. Early symptoms may include fever, headache, and feeling tired. This is then typically followed by psychosis which presents with false beliefs (delusions) and seeing or hearing things that others do not see or hear (hallucinations).

What are pain receptors stimulated by?

Transduction. Three types of stimuli can activate pain receptors in peripheral tissues: mechanical (pressure, pinch), heat, and chemical. Mechanical and heat stimuli are usually brief, whereas chemical stimuli are usually long lasting. Nothing is known about how these stimuli activate nociceptors.

What are Beta 2 agonists examples?

The side effects of beta-2 agonists include anxiety, tremor, palpitations or fast heart rate, and low blood potassium. Examples of beta-2 agonists include albuterol (Ventolin, Proventil), metaproterenol (Alupent), pirbuterol (Maxair), terbutaline (Brethaire), isoetharine (Bronkosol), and Levalbuterol (Xopenex).

How do internal receptors work?

Internal receptors, also known as intracellular or cytoplasmic receptors, are found in the cytoplasm of the cell and respond to hydrophobic ligand molecules that are able to travel across the plasma membrane. Once inside the cell, many of these molecules bind to proteins that act as regulators of mRNA synthesis.

What is the death receptor pathway?

The extrinsic pathway involves the binding of ligands to cell surface ‘death receptors’ (DR) which in turn initiates the caspase cascade. 8. Death receptors are part of the tumour necrosis factor (TNF) gene superfamily and provide a rapid and efficient route to apoptosis.

Where are mu opioid receptors located in the body?

μ receptors are the main functional target of morphine and morphine-like drugs; they are present in large quantities in the PAG matter in the brain and the substantia gelatinosa in the spinal cord. μ receptors are also found in the peripheral nerves and skin.
